The Mark for Education Foundation held its 10th annual event at McLevy Green.
Students, parents, and teachers participated.
Organizers said their focus is on kids who need encouragement as they attend school.
Bridgeport Mayor Joe Ganim said, “With an education, you can do anything. I mean, that’s what my parents told me. They said, ‘look, I don’t care what you do with your life, just get an education and it’s up to you.’ So part of what today is, is allowing young people to understand the importance of education, highlighting their skills, things like their talents, and recognize how important an education is.”
Organizers say education for all children was the goal of supporters who took part in similar events across the region.
